Congress Expands Post 9/11 G.I. Bill Benefits
  Thanks to the hard work of the DAV and its supporters, Congress made vital improvements to the Post 9/11 G.I. Bill at the end of the last session. The new legislation provides more opportunities for vocational training, expands eligibility for National Guard members, and provides severely injured veterans with more time to use their benefits.

DAV Focuses on Care for Women Veterans
DAV Focuses on Care for Women Veterans   Committed to reversing longstanding inequality among service members, the DAV joined other groups to host a forum on VA healthcare for women veterans. DAV National Adjutant Art Wilson declared that "the DAV is determined to work with the VA to provide these women with the excellent care they earned through their sacrifice."
